Typical Issues with Windows and DoorsWindows
Drafts
Triggered by deteriorating seals or used weather removing.Causes energy inefficiency and increased heating or cooling costs.
Fractures or Breaks in Glass
Can result from impact, severe temperatures, or manufacturing defects.Compromises safety and energy efficiency.
Difficulty Opening or Closing
May emerge from misalignment, rust, or debris build-up in tracks.
Condensation Between Glass Panes
Shows seal failure in double or triple-pane windows.Outcomes in decreased insulation and presence.Doors
Wood Rot
Common in wooden doors, particularly at the base.Brought on by water direct exposure, causing structural stability problems.
Misalignment
Can occur due to settling of the home or damaged hinges.Lead to trouble closing and possible security risks.
Harmed Weather Stripping
Deteriorates gradually, permitting air leakages.Decreases energy efficiency and convenience levels inside your home.
Broken Locks or Handles

Regular Inspections
Look for signs of wear, water damage, and drafts a minimum of two times a year.
Tidy Tracks and Frames
Eliminate particles from window tracks and door frames to make sure smooth operation.
Change Weather Stripping
Replace worn weather stripping every couple of years to maintain energy performance.
Paint and Seal
Keep wood doors painted and sealed to avoid moisture penetration.
Oil Hinges and Mechanisms

How can I inform if my door requires repair or replacement?
Search for considerable damage, such as wood rot or comprehensive warping. If repairs would cost majority the cost of a replacement, it may be more cost-effective to change the door.
What is the average expense of window repairs?
Costs differ commonly based upon the type of repair and products required, but general window repairs normally vary from ₤ 100 to ₤ 600.
How frequently should I perform maintenance checks on my windows and doors?
It is advised to inspect them a minimum of two times a year, preferably throughout seasonal changes.
Can I repair fogged windows myself?
Small cases of fogging may be resolved with repair sets, but for considerable seal failures, professional replacement of the window system is often the finest solution.
